Shooting and Passing

Precision Shooting represents the most significant advancement in EA FC 26’s offensive mechanics. Unlike traditional shooting systems, Precision requires manual aiming within a smaller target area, rewarding skilled players with dramatically improved shot placement and goal-scoring consistency. This setting separates elite attackers from average players by enabling pinpoint accuracy when targeting specific corners of the goal.

  • Preset: Competitive
  • Shooting: Precision
  • Through Pass Assistance: Semi
  • Lobbed Through Pass: Semi
  • Ground Pass Assistance: Assisted
  • Cross Assistance: Assisted
  • Lob Pass Assistance: Assisted
  • Pass Receiver Lock: Late
  • Precision Pass Stability: Normal

Common Mistake: Many players immediately switch all passing settings to Manual, overlooking the strategic balance between control and consistency. Semi through passes provide the ideal middle ground, allowing directional influence while maintaining reasonable pass completion rates during high-pressure situations.

Defending

Advanced Defending transforms your defensive capabilities by introducing manual tackling controls and positioning requirements. This system replaces the automated defending of previous titles, demanding precise timing and spatial awareness to successfully dispossess opponents.

  • Clearance Assistance: Directional
  • Defending: Advanced Defending
  • Professional Fouls: Off
  • Pass Block Assistance: On

Switching

Player switching configuration critically impacts defensive organization and transition play. Optimal settings ensure seamless control transitions during counter-attacks and organized defensive shapes.

  • Auto Switching: On Air Balls and Loose Balls
  • Auto Switching Move Assistance: None
  • Right Stick Switching: Classic
  • Right Stick Switching Reference: Player Relative
  • Right Stick Switching Sensitivity: 4
  • Next Player Switching: Classic
  • Reaction Time Calibration: Off
  • Player Lock: On

Pro Tip: Setting Right Stick Switching Sensitivity to 4 provides the perfect balance between responsiveness and precision, preventing accidental player selection during intense defensive sequences.

Dribbling

  • Simplified Skill Moves: Based on Personal Preference

Simplified Skill Moves introduces a revolutionary accessibility feature that dramatically simplifies executing advanced dribbling techniques. By manipulating the right analog stick, your controlled player performs context-appropriate skill moves determined by their SM star rating. While incredibly convenient, this setting restricts your available move repertoire to just nine variations from over fifty options in the game. Consequently, if you’ve mastered the traditional input combinations, maintaining this option disabled preserves your full technical arsenal.

Controller Preferences

  • Analog Sprint: Off
  • Trigger Effect: Off
  • User Vibration Feedback: Off

Performance Optimization: Disabling vibration feedback and analog sprint eliminates potential input latency and controller vibration interference during critical gameplay moments. These adjustments ensure cleaner command execution when precision matters most.
